Drivers and information. Windows can find and download two kinds of updates for devices connected to your computer: Drivers. A driver is software that allows your computer to communicate with hardware devices. Without drivers, the devices you connect to your computer—for example, a mouse or external hard drive—won't work properly. At LAVA, we design and manufacture computing interfaces and devices for the Point of Sale, Kiosk, Gaming, Industrial Automation, Security and Access Control industries, and have been doing so since 1984. As experts in serial interfaces for PCI, PCIe, ISA, USB, and Ethernet buses, we build Ethernet-to-serial device servers, serial/parallel I/O boards, embedded IoT/M2M connectivity devices, and tablet PoE/USB/LAN devices.

With over a million LAVA products built into workstations, servers, retail POS systems, and industrial computers, LAVA products are trusted by resellers, distributors, OEMs and system builders in over 47 countries worldwide.

Power over Ethernet (PoE)


In many contexts, PoE enabled devices can be easily installed. The Power over Ethernet specification is a simple design, that uses existing Ethernet cabling to deliver power and data to a device using one cable. Eliminated is the need for running separate power, often eliminating the need for a power brick as well.

Real-world RS-232

As the RS-232 serial port became less common in the consumer marketplace for things such as modems and printers, people gained the impression that it had actually disappeared. But in fact, RS-232 serial is still found in many items we use daily, including GPSes, cars, home weather stations, and televisions.


Some GPS data is available on RS-232 serial. Garmin GPSes have used RS-232 in their handheld GPSes, for instance.
Downloading waypoints, or adding high acquisition rate or high sensitivity GPS hardware are other applications where RS-232 finds a place. >>>

Who knew? Lots of today’s TVs have RS-232 ports that can be used to control many aspects of their operation, including things you can’t do with your handheld remote. Add an Ether-Serial Link to the mix and you can control multiple TVs from anywhere!

Applications on the shop floor

Serial and parallel technologies are staples of automation and machining operations, where simplicity and reliability are keys.

RS-232 and RS-422 are frequently-used interfaces for programming Programmable Logic Controls (PLCs). The automation and control industries appreciate the simplicity and reliability of serial connections.
